How they compare
Gabon currently reports 0.0337 units per person against 0.025 units per person in Rwanda, a difference of 0.0087 units per person.
That makes Gabon's figure about 1.3 times Rwanda's.
Across all 16 years both countries report, Gabon has been ahead every year.
Gabon ranks 1st and Rwanda ranks 3rd of 196 countries.
Gabon has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
